Crispy Zucchini Chips Recipe

Thinly sliced zucchini coated with Parmesan and spices, baked or air-fried to golden perfection for a light, crispy, and flavorful snack.

Ingredients

  • 2 medium zucchini, thinly sliced (about 1/8 inch thick)
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1/2 tsp garlic powder
  • 1/2 tsp paprika
  • Salt and black pepper, to taste
  • Optional: 1/2 tsp dried herbs like oregano or thyme

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C) or air fryer to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Pat zucchini slices dry with paper towels to remove excess moisture.
  3. In a bowl, toss zucchini slices with olive oil, Parmesan,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and pepper until evenly coated.
  4. Arrange slices in a single layer on a parchment-lined baking sheet or in the air fryer basket.
  5. Bake for 20–25 minutes, flipping halfway through, until golden and crispy; or air fry for 10–15 minutes, shaking halfway.
  6. Serve immediately for maximum crispiness.

Notes

  • Add chili powder or cayenne for a spicy version.
  • Swap Parmesan for nutritional yeast for a vegan alternative.
  • Fresh herbs like rosemary or thyme can be sprinkled after baking for aroma.
  • Best enjoyed fresh; store at room temperature in an airtight container for up to 1 day.
  • Reheat in oven or air fryer for a few minutes to restore crispiness.
